Output 44c99a5b3dc19fc950e8c5a844c8f0228371c9e70a668f858654629d40283e1d:0

value
29711460
script pubkey
OP_0 OP_PUSHBYTES_20 85594523a08ee41bc2a92c3927181baf3e369e87
address
bc1qs4v52gaq3mjphs4f9sujwxqm4ulrd8585y4khg
transaction
44c99a5b3dc19fc950e8c5a844c8f0228371c9e70a668f858654629d40283e1d
confirmations
261095
spent
true